I've never been to Lyon, France, but apparently it was the place to be on September 25-26 of last month when Lyon hosted the Blockchain Game Summit. Many of the brightest minds in blockchain technology gathered to brainstorm and educate on the future of gaming. Among them, was Nicolas Sierro, of Everdreamsoft, an innovative Swiss company.
My husband @joechiappetta has long been impressed with Everdreamsoft products and is part of their BitCrystals Community. However, one of the things that really sets Everdreamsoft apart from the crowd in terms of innovation, is the fact that artists can directly issue their own rare digital art as trading cards and sell them in Everdreamsoft's CrystalsCraft Collection. Joe has sold many cards using this platform, so it was cool to see his designs on the "big screen" as they were presented at the conference.
